Depth of Game Selection and Provider Integrity

I assess a casino not by the number of slot thumbnails on the lobby page, but by the breadth of the studios behind those games. A healthy library mixes giants like NetEnt and Play’n GO with niche innovators who produce high-risk, mechanically unique titles. If the lobby is filled with only one provider’s catalog, the platform likely operates on a white-label solution with minimal curation effort.

Live casino verticals require a distinct scrutiny. I check if the tables are streamed from professional studios with multi-camera setups and experienced dealers. Latency and video bitrate stability are non-negotiable for a fair live experience. I also verify whether the platform offers native tables with localized language support, as this indicates a meaningful investment in the player experience rather than a generic embedded feed.

Table game limits reveal the operator’s risk appetite. I look for low minimums that allow casual players to stretch a modest deposit, alongside VIP tables that accommodate calculated high-stakes strategies. A platform that only offers micro-stakes or only caters to high rollers is signaling a restricted operational focus that may not suit a diverse international audience.

Terms & Conditions Transparency

I went through the full terms document so you don’t need to, but I shall inform you what to look for. The key clause controls maximum withdrawal limits from bonus funds. Some operators cap winnings from promotional play at a fixed multiple of the bonus received, indicating even if you land a enormous jackpot while wagering, you will only obtain a fraction of the displayed balance. I point out this right away if the cap is not prominently disclosed on the promotion page itself.

Dormancy fees are an additional clause I track down. An account that stays inactive for a uninterrupted period, generally twelve months, may accrue a monthly administrative deduction until the balance reaches zero. A open operator dispatches multiple email reminders before activating this fee and provides a simple mechanism to restore the account by logging in. If the clause is obscured and the fee is steep, I regard it a adverse design pattern.

I also scrutinize the arbitration and dispute resolution section. A fair terms document guides you to an independent third-party adjudicator approved by the licensing body. If the terms force binding arbitration in a location that is uncomfortable or pricey for you to access, the operator is essentially insulating itself from accountability. I always verify that the dispute path is workable and explicitly mapped out.

Breaking down the Sign-up Offer

A headline number like “100% up to a limit” is pointless without the terms attached. I right away calculate the wagering requirement, which is the multiplier dictating how much total action you must play before withdrawing. A lower multiplier combined with a longer clearance window gives you a practical shot at converting bonus funds into real cash, whereas a steep multiplier with a seven-day limit is numerically oppressive.

I pay careful attention to game weighting because it can determine the success of a promotion. Usually, slots contribute one hundred percent toward the playthrough, but table games like blackjack or roulette often contribute only five or ten percent. If you accidentally play a restricted game while a bonus is active, many systems will void your accrued winnings instantly, so I always scan the excluded games list before recommending an offer.

Maximum bet rules are another hidden killer. Most bonuses cap your stake size during wagering, often at a flat five currency units per spin or hand. Exceeding this limit, even by accident, triggers an automatic forfeiture clause. I test the platform’s real-time enforcement of this rule because a good interface should warn you before you place a violating bet, not punish you after the fact.

FAQ

How can I confirm an online casino license is genuine?

Locate the license number and issuing authority logo in the website footer. Access the regulator’s official public register and input the number. The register will display the operator’s legal name and the specific domains and gaming categories included. Should the number fail to match, the license is either fraudulent or has been withdrawn.

How is a wagering requirement defined and why does it matter?

A wagering requirement is a multiplier applied to your bonus amount or bonus plus deposit. It determines the total sum you must bet before withdrawing bonus-derived winnings. A 30x requirement on a 100 bonus indicates you must wager 3,000. Lower multipliers with longer timeframes provide a realistic chance of converting bonus funds into withdrawable cash.

Can I play live dealer games with a bonus active?

Generally, but with significant caveats. Most promotions assign a drastically reduced contribution weight to live games, often between zero and ten percent. This implies a 100 wager on live roulette might only count as 10 toward your playthrough. Always check the game weighting table in the bonus terms before launching a live dealer table.

Why do casinos ask documents before a withdrawal?

This is a legal mandate referred to as Know Your Customer. The operator is required to confirm your personal details, age, and address to stop fraud and money laundering. Trusted operators enable you to upload documents ahead of time. If a platform only asks for them when you try to cash out, it may be using the delay to push you to reverse the withdrawal.

Is a mobile website as safe as a installed app?

Absolutely, provided the mobile site runs over a safe HTTPS connection and you access it through an current browser. A PWA does not need the same device permissions an downloaded app might request. Always avoid saving passwords on shared devices and turn on two-factor authentication whether or not you use the browser or a specific app.

What steps should I take if a withdrawal is postponed beyond the stated time?

First, ensure your account verification is fully approved and no documents are pending. Contact support via live chat and request a concrete update and a transaction reference. If the delay surpasses their published maximum without a valid explanation, lodge a formal dispute through the licensing authority’s dispute resolution service referenced in the terms and conditions.

Player Mechanics and Genuine Benefit

I eliminate the cosmetic packaging of a VIP program to expose its numerical skeleton. A points-based system where you accumulate one point per ten currency units wagered is only valuable if the redemption rate for bonus cash is fair and the playthrough on redeemed rewards is low or nonexistent. I calculate the effective rakeback percentage because that single number penetrates all the marketing fluff about exclusive events and dedicated hosts.

Level progression speed counts. Some programs require an astronomical turnover to achieve a level where the perks become tangible, effectively locking ninety-nine percent of players into a tier with insignificant benefits. I prefer programs that front-load value, delivering concrete rewards like free spins with low wagering requirements at lower tiers, rather than reserving all utility for the top one percent of high rollers.

Protection Standards Beyond the Padlock

The padlock icon in the address bar is the least requirement, not a selling point. I analyze the actual TLS certificate issuer and the cipher suite robustness. More importantly, I check session timeout behavior. A secure platform signs you out after a period of inactivity, preventing unauthorized access on shared or lost devices. This option should be adjustable in the account preferences, not hardcoded to an inconveniently short window.

Two-factor authentication presence is a key element in my assessment. rds.ca I search for authenticator app integration rather than just SMS-based codes, as SIM-swapping attacks leave SMS verification susceptible. A casino that focuses on solid account security framework is also prone to invest in backend server hardening and intrusion detection systems that safeguard your personal data from database breaches.

I also examine the responsible gaming tools as a security feature. Deposit limits, loss limits, and session time reminders are not just wellness features. They are critical safety defenses that shield you from account takeover scenarios where a malicious actor tries to drain your balance quickly. A platform that enables you to set these limits instantly, but imposes a cooling-off period before increasing them, demonstrates genuine duty of care.

Payment Rails and Withdrawal System

I map out the entire deposit and withdrawal flow before funding an account. The presence of modern e-wallets, instant banking protocols, and cryptocurrency rails indicates the operator values speed and anonymity. I also note whether the cashier page shows processing times upfront or places them in a separate FAQ. Transparency here is tightly linked with overall operational honesty.

Withdrawal pending periods are a friction point I examine ruthlessly. A standard internal review window of twenty-four to forty-eight hours is acceptable, but anything beyond seventy-two hours suggests manual processing bottlenecks or deliberate stalling tactics. I also check whether the platform reverses pending withdrawals on request, a feature that can be useful but is often weaponized to encourage impulsive re-gambling of funds you intended to cash out.

I examine the verification protocol, often called KYC. A smooth operation allows you to upload identity documents directly through a secure portal before a withdrawal is requested. Operations that wait until you try to cash out to demand documents are deliberately creating a cooling-off period to pressure you into canceling the payout. I always prefer platforms that encourage pre-emptive verification.

Helpdesk Performance Evaluation

I do not merely verify if live chat exists. I initiate a discussion at an uncommon hour and pose a complicated question about bonus terms or document rejection reasons. I measure the opening response and measure how many scripted macro replies I receive before a human agent interacts with the precise details of my query. A support team that reviews your message and answers with customized information is of greater value than any deposit bonus.

Language coverage is a real-world concern for an worldwide player base. I check whether the support team can transition between languages mid-session without losing track of context. I also verify if the same quality of service applies to email ticketing, as some operations funnel all resources into chat while abandoning email queues unresolved for days. A consistent multi-channel standard indicates mature operational management.

I review the self-help knowledge base as well. A comprehensive FAQ and help center should resolve most technical questions without requiring human contact. I seek articles with actual screenshots of the interface, step-by-step troubleshooting guides, and clear explanations of error codes. If the help center is just a wall of text taken from a generic template, the operator has not invested in user education.

The Licensing Test of Credibility

When I land on a homepage, I do not look at the bonus banner first. I go directly to the footer to confirm the regulatory badge. A legitimate operation will display its license number prominently, and I compare that number against the official public register of the issuing authority. This ensures the operator is not simply placing a fake logo onto the page for cosmetic credibility.

The jurisdiction matters because it dictates your legal recourse. Reputable regulators require strict player fund segregation, meaning your deposited money is held in a protected account separate from the company’s operational cash. If a brand holds a license from a tier-one jurisdiction, I understand they have passed rigorous anti-money laundering checks and technical system audits that test the randomness of their games.

I also check for the specific language of the license. Some badges only cover sports betting, leaving the casino vertical unregulated. A transparent platform ensures the license covers all interactive gaming categories it presents. If I cannot verify the license within sixty seconds, that is a critical red flag I never ignore, and neither should you.
